How to Season Ground Turkey for Breakfast Burritos

Breakfast burritos are a delightful way to start your day with a burst of flavor and nutrition. Ground turkey, being a lean and versatile protein, is a fantastic choice for these savory wraps. The key to a delicious breakfast burrito lies in the seasoning you use.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to season ground turkey for breakfast burritos that will leave you craving more every morning.

1. Choose the Right Turkey

Before you start seasoning, ensure you’re using high-quality ground turkey. Look for turkey that’s labeled as 90% lean or higher to ensure that you’re getting the most flavor without excess fat.

2. Gather Your Seasonings

The seasoning you choose can make a world of difference. Here are some essential ingredients to consider:

– Salt and pepper: These are the basics, but don’t underestimate their power.
– Garlic powder: Adds depth and a hint of warmth.
– Onion powder: Brings out the savory notes in the turkey.
– Cumin: A classic spice for Mexican cuisine, giving it a distinct flavor.
– Paprika: Adds a bit of heat and a rich color to the turkey.
– Chili powder: For a bit more heat and complexity.
– Oregano: A must-have for any Mexican dish.
– Thyme: Adds a subtle earthiness.

3. Season the Turkey

Add the ground turkey to a large bowl. Sprinkle the sal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, cumin, paprika, chili powder, oregano, and thyme over the turkey. Use your hands to mix the seasonings thoroughly, ensuring that every piece of turkey is evenly coated.

4. Cook the Turkey

Heat a large skillet over medium heat. Add a small amount of oil or cooking spray. Once the skillet is hot, add the seasoned ground turkey. Cook, breaking it up with a spatula, until it’s fully cooked and no longer pink. This should take about 5-7 minutes, depending on the thickness of the turkey.

5. Add Additional Flavors

While the turkey is cooking, you can add additional ingredients to enhance the flavor. Consider adding diced onions, bell peppers, or even a can of black beans for extra texture and protein.

6. Assemble Your Breakfast Burritos

Once the turkey is cooked, let it cool slightly. In the meantime, warm your tortillas according to package instructions. Place a tortilla on a plate, add a layer of cooked turkey, your choice of additional fillings (such as cheese, avocado, or salsa), and fold it over to form a burrito.

7. Serve and Enjoy

Serve your breakfast burritos hot, and don’t forget a side of your favorite hot sauce or salsa for an extra kick. Enjoy your homemade breakfast burritos, and feel free to experiment with different seasonings and fillings to create your perfect morning meal.
